@GetNTComPortModemStatus
NTComPort
Syntax
@GetNTComPortModemStatus(OSCOMHANDLE1);
Description
Only for the Engine under Windows!
Current status of a modem on COM port with OSCOMHANDLE OSCOMHANDLE1 query and return.
Return value:
Bit HEX C-Symbol meaning
5 0010 MS_CTS_ON The CTS-line is HIGH
6 0020 MS_DSR_ON The DSR-line is HIGH
7 0040 MS_RING_ON The ring indicator signal is HIGH
8 0080 MS_RLSD_ON The RLSD-signal (DCD) is HIGH
Example: @GetNTComPortModemStatus(OSCOMHANDLE1);
OSCOMHANDLE1:=@OpenNTComPort("COM1");
@LogReport(@GetNTComPortModemStatus(OSCOMHANDLE1));OSCOMHANDLE1:=@CloseNTComPort(OSCOMHANDLE1);
Opens a COM port, queries the modem status from, outputs them to log file and closes it then again.
